Course Description
Most landlords and real estate investors know that owning rental property offers one of the best opportunities to build a steady stream of income and gain long term appreciation of property values. The question is how to go from purchasing a rental property to actually renting your property and managing the day-to-day activities required of a landlord.
Becoming a successful landlord requires a thorough understanding and appreciation of the rewards, the risks and the responsibilities of owning and managing rental property.
Tidewater Community College's 15 hour Landlord Training Program: How to Become a Successful Landlord, with Certificate of Achievement, offers landlords and prospective landlords the tools and the knowledge to not only manage their rental property smoothly and competently, but to protect their long term interest by becoming a confident, reputable and successful landlord.
Topics covered in the 15 hour Landlord Training Program include:
- Investment property
- The Virginia Residential Landlord Tenant Act
- Fair Housing
- Local housing requirements and inspections
- Marketing your home for rent
- Tenant screening
- The Lease
- Security deposits
- Move-in and move-out inspections
- Maintenance and repairs
- Renewals and evictions
- Bookkeeping and finance
